Connection to Squid Easy Сaching Proxy Server on Ubuntu 20.04. using Windows Settings

  1. Launch VM through your Azure account. When starting the VM proxy server starts automatically. Also, you should open port 3128 (TCP).
  2. To use the proxy server through the built-in Windows tools, you must open the settings.
  1. In Settings select “Network & Internet”.
  1. Go to the “Proxy” section and set the “Use a proxy server” switch to On.
  2. In the “Address field”, enter the address of the VM, and in the “Port” field, specify 3128. Then click the “Save” button.
  1. To check the connection to the proxy server, open the https://www.myip.com/ website in any browser and check if your IP address has changed.
